Start with running mkheaders which will be in your path somewhere like
<path-to-base-gcc-install>/lib/gcc/<platform-os>/install-tools/ or
<path-to-base-gcc-install>/libexec/gcc/<platform-os>/install-tools/
depending on how your gcc was built. This should fix your problem with
ctid_t
Tony Bourke integrated the changes outlined by Dan Price above into the
super-smack-1.3 release. I can't remember for certain, but it seems
like there may have still been a problem with yacc that I had to comment
a couple of lines from. I was building on a T2000, though.
